Output c81c390320cb94d74c43e1e87e7184cf99c21d4c12c25a7de699fdb42a7ed1a9:0

value
1181317
script pubkey
OP_0 OP_PUSHBYTES_20 5d5adf7a1dcfca7ce50c15fdd97d5a55117b8203
address
bc1qt4dd77sael98eegvzh7ajl2625ghhqsrpvrgqv
transaction
c81c390320cb94d74c43e1e87e7184cf99c21d4c12c25a7de699fdb42a7ed1a9
confirmations
36305
spent
true